Its terribly bad stock, why would you want to make it worse? Don't tell me you don't notice in summer traffic. or even on a mild day when you come back to drive your car after its been sitting for 45min. Terrible heat bog. Yeah its a big consideration. The only way I would think about getting an after market header is if it made proven gains in the rpm range I want and I would wrap the hell out of it. This will quiet it down as well, which is something else to consider when you already have a loud I.E
i have been tru many header, ebay header, megan header, berk header,J's header and now toda header(to work in conjuction with my06+reflash)..all of them are wrapped all the way to the TP...i really love it, sound a little less louder and stop and go traffic is much better( but i can still feel that car is having some heat soak problems but its better.).
vented hoods i think would help as well on those hot days to desipate those heat.
in addition, i painted my toda header with some high temp paint and i painted it using two cans of flat black paint, i really took my time on this one, and i hope this will help the temp to drop a bit more....
